Crawford Pass Trail
A ledge-top trail with Grand Staircase views.
About
Crawford Pass Trail #33047 runs 2.3 miles one-way through Dixie National Forest about 29 miles north-northeast of Kanab, dropping from roughly 8,600 feet to 8,440 feet with about 786 feet of accumulated elevation gain along the way. The trail travels above a band of pink ledges before gradually dropping below them, tracing the base of the cliffs down to the lower trailhead — with views out toward the Grand Staircase along the way.
Trail basics
- 2.3 miles one-way, open to hiking and horse riding
- Tent and trailer camping available at the trailhead
- Reached via East Fork Road and Crawford Pass Road off SR-12
This is Forest Service land, so dogs are generally allowed and dispersed camping is common in the area. High-elevation roads here can be rough or snowed in outside the summer season, so check current conditions before heading out.
